Where each falls short
The honest trade-offs — what you give up with each, versus the proprietary tools they replace.
Caddy
- Not a full PaaS; no git push deploy, build pipelines, or app lifecycle management
- No built-in CI/CD integration; needs to be combined with other tools for deployments
- Dashboard and metrics require third-party tools (Prometheus, Grafana) — none built-in
- No managed database provisioning or environment variable secrets management
Kubero
- Requires an existing, properly configured Kubernetes cluster, which raises the operational bar significantly.
- Smaller community and ecosystem than the leading PaaS projects.
- Fewer one-click add-ons and integrations than Heroku's marketplace.
- No managed hosting or edge/CDN; everything depends on your cluster.
